Raglan takes all reports of anti-social behaviour (ASB) very seriously. Some incidents, however, are a lot more serious than others. A grading system (1 - 4) is used to categorise all ASB incidents that are reported to Raglan. This enables the appropriate action to be taken in response to complaints.
